Chapter 89
“You’re ginger?” Indianna said, raising her eyebrows at Kimberly, who was drying her wet hair.
“Naturally,” Kimberly nodded. “I used to… um… get bullied because of it, so I dyed it.”
“To fit in?” Indianna guessed, and Kimberly nodded. “That’s why, isn’t it? Why you act so harshly to others? Because you were bullied?”
Kimberly coughed and sent Indianna a sharp look. “I don’t want to talk about that,” she muttered and ran her fingers through her hair.
“You look pretty,” Indianna said quietly.
Kimberly did, now that she was stripped natural. Her normal hair color suited her much more, and her face wasn’t caked in its usual makeup.
Kimberly frowned. “I do?”
Indianna nodded. “Kal prefers natural. Inside and out.”
“Inside will be a lot harder than outside,” Kimberly muttered. “It’s been a while since I’ve been nice to someone.”
